Algirdas Matonis (born November 21, 1960 ) is a Lithuanian lawyer, criminal investigator and police superintendent , head of the Lithuanian Criminal Police Office (2005-2014).

Life

In 1986 he graduated from the Vilniaus valstybinis V. Kapsuko universitetas with a degree in law . From September 1991 he worked as an inspector and from April 1993 as chief inspector of the criminal police in Druskininkai . From April 1999 he worked as a commissioner inspector at the police department at the Ministry of the Interior of Lithuania , from 2000 as a commissioner, from December 2003 head of the subdivision. From 2005 to 2014 he headed the Lithuanian criminal police . From April 2014 he works for the security company Gelsauga .
